Transaction ce72b7d36edef8156837359a378b50615157e324210584947283081d79508cc4

3 Input
2 Outputs
  • ce72b7d36edef8156837359a378b50615157e324210584947283081d79508cc4:0
  • value  1000428
    address  122DfksaG6UgkMQRFeNnMzvBsUcUEXGB84
  • ce72b7d36edef8156837359a378b50615157e324210584947283081d79508cc4:1
  • value  500001
    address  16iV7KuRA4c668Vqnjr4Ed5GiAi33vYwuc